Listener:
org.zkoss.zk.ui.util.Monitor
A listener could implement Monitor to monitor the statuses of ZK. Unlike other listeners, there is at most one monitor listener for each Web application. If you like, you can chain them together manually.
ZK provides an implementation named Statistic, which accumulates the statistic data in the memory. It is a good starting point to understand the load of your ZK application.
Instantiation: Unlike most other listeners, at most one monitor is allowed in one application. In additions, it is shared, so the implementation must be thread safe.
